Antisemitic incidents are on the rise around Australia

Antisemitic incidents are on the rise around Australia, according to the latest research by the Executive Council of Australian Jewry.

The council’s annual report into antisemitism found there were 478 antisemitic incidents lodged with the group in the year to September 2022, up from 447 in 2021.

There were 180 more incidents compared with the 2013 to 2021 annual average.

The biggest increase across all categories of incidents was in posters – including banners, clothing, leaflets and flyers – believed to be in part due to Covid protests, according to researcher Julie Nathan.

She said:

The Covid regulations … produced mass street protests, particularly in Victoria, and the antisemitic conspiracy theories associated with the anti-vaxxer, anti-lockdown camp, resulted in large numbers of antisemitic placards at protests and antisemitic stickers on the streets.

Secondly, there was an increase in neo-Nazi activity, propagating antisemitic propaganda material in the form of posters, stickers and the like.

Nathan said the annual report captured just the “tip of the iceberg” of what was happening around the country.
